Introduction

  1. Visit the Delhi government transport website- www.delhi.gov.in.
  2. Fill the application form and submit it online.
  3. You will then receive an application number that you will require at the time of the test.
  4. Proceed ahead with booking a learning license test slot.

Also the question is, can I apply learning licence online in Delhi? Applying for a learner’s licence in Delhi can be done either through the online portals or offline through the RTO office closest to you. For anyone to obtain a permanent driving licence, they must have a valid learner’s licence issued by the Delhi Regional Transport Office.

You asked, when can we apply for learning license in Delhi? Eligibility for obtaining a Lerner’s Licence: – Section 4 provides that a person who has completed sixteen years of age may obtain a driving licence to drive a motor cycle without gear whose engine capacity does not exceed 50 cc with the consent of parent/guardian of the applicant.

People ask also, what is the fee for learning driving licence in Delhi? Fees for Driving Licence Grant – Rs. 40. Fees for Driving Licence Test – Rs. 100.

Amazingly, is driving test required for learning licence in Delhi? Ans. No, in case of private or non-commercial vehicles, it is not compulsory. However, in case of commercial vehicles, it is compulsory because the Motor Driving School has to issue Form No. 5 for commercial driving licence.1) Under the faceless services of the Transport department, people can now apply for an online test for learners’ licence from the comfort of home.
